Are you gonna hook it directly to a spigot or will you need an adapter to run it from a kitchen/bathroom faucet?
 
As an Amazon Associate we earn from qualifying purchases.
You can use one of these to tap into the cold water supply of a kitchen or bathroom sink, it's easier if they are a flex hose supply line not a rigid copper pipe.
http://www.bulkreefsupply.com/mur-lok-ez-angle-stop-adapter.html

200814-reverse-osmosis-ro-john-guest-angle-stop-valve-qc-grouped-a.jpg


I used this with a ball valve in the rodi water supply to easily turn it off and on. I would stick the waste line in the sink overflow when it was running.

My current setup is off the cold water washing machine supply line in the laundry room, so that's another option with a different fitting
